Just a short note to report that after a period where these were not evident, I
am again experiencing important rendering issues on gen4 graphics card.
Some details:
Hardware DELL E6500
OS: kubuntu 13.04 + kernel updated to 3.9.5 via ubuntu mainline ppa
Graphics stack:
xorg core 1.13.3
xserver xorg video intel driver 2.21.9+
(git snapshot taken 13-06-11 - b9439a...)
libdrm 2.4.45+
(git snapshot taken 13-06-07 - a0178c...)
mesa 9.2+
(git snapshot taken 13-06-11 - 761320...)
The artifacts are particularly evident in
- firefox (see attachment)
- libreoffice
In both cases the artifacts affect not just what is rendered, but also the
thumbnails created by the application (those in firefox start page and slide
and drawing thumbnails in libreoffice impress/draw).
Artifacts interest squared chunks on the screen where patterns appear instead
of images.
